Job Title: Data/Software Engineer


Location: Remote


Industry: Pharmaceutical


***NO C2C***


Job Description:

Theoris Services is assisting our client in their search for a Data/Software Engineer to add to their growing team. Our client is seeking someone with data visualization experience and software engineering (create reusable libraries, best practices, troubleshooting).


Responsibilities:

  • Data Pipeline & Backend Development
  • Design, build, and optimize scalable data pipelines and ETL/ELT processes to integrate and harmonize scientific data (compounds, assays, experiments) from 30+ heterogeneous sources.
  • Implement and maintain lakehouse architectures on AWS (S3, Glue, Athena, Iceberg) to support multibillion-record datasets.
  • Develop federated query capabilities using Trino (or similar distributed engines) for unified access across platforms like PostgreSQL, Snowflake, and others.
  • Build robust backend services, RESTful APIs, and data services using Python (FastAPI, Flask preferred) to enable seamless data flow and integration with scientific tools (e.g., Benchling, computational chemistry systems, AI/ML endpoints).
  • Performance Optimization & Troubleshooting
  • Optimize query and database performance for complex analytical workloads across PostgreSQL, Iceberg, Trino, and other platforms.
  • Implement caching, indexing, and query tuning techniques to improve response times and scalability as data volumes and user bases grow.
  • Apply reverse engineering and advanced troubleshooting skills to debug complex data issues, pipeline bottlenecks, application failures, and performance problems proactively.
  • Monitor systems, identify root causes, and implement fixes for data and application reliability.
  • Data Visualization & User-Facing Analytics
  • Design and develop interactive dashboards, visual analytics, and scientific data visualizations using Power BI and Spotfire (or equivalent tools).
  • Create reusable visualization components and data-rich UIs (React/TypeScript preferred) to enable scientists to search, filter, explore, and interpret complex datasets—including dose-response curves, chemical structures, and analytical results.
  • Translate scientific and engineering data into clear, actionable visual insights for researchers and stakeholders.
  • Software Engineering & Quality Practices
  • Apply best software engineering practices: modular/reusable design, clean code principles, code reviews, comprehensive documentation, and creation of maintainable libraries/services.
  • Write high-quality unit, integration, and end-to-end tests; use mock data effectively to create reliable automated test cases and ensure code stability.
  • Implement CI/CD pipelines for automated testing, deployment, and monitoring on AWS (EC2, ECS, Lambda, S3).
  • Collaborate on full-stack features from database to frontend, ensuring end-to-end functionality, security (SSO/LDAP), and performance.
  • Collaboration & Governance
  • Partner with scientists, UX designers, and cross-functional teams to gather requirements, conduct user testing, and iterate on usability.
  • Implement data validation, quality checks, metadata management, and governance to ensure compliance and accuracy.
  • Contribute to engineering best practices and foster a culture of quality and scalability.


Requirements:

  • Education &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Data Engineering, Software Engineering, Information Systems, or a related technical field.
  • 3+ years of professional experience in data engineering, full-stack development, or closely related roles.
  • Proven track record of building and delivering production-grade data pipelines, platforms, and/or user-facing scientific applications.
  • Technical Skills
  • Programming: Intermediate to strong proficiency in Python (core for pipelines, backend, and data manipulation with pandas/PySpark); familiarity with JavaScript/TypeScript for frontend.
  • Data Engineering: Hands-on experience creating scalable pipelines, ETL/ELT processes, and distributed processing (Spark, Trino/Presto).
  • Databases & Querying: Deep expertise in relational databases (PostgreSQL), modern warehouses (Snowflake, Redshift), and query engines; strong focus on query performance improvement and optimization.
  • Cloud Platforms: Practical experience with AWS services (S3, Glue, Athena, Lambda, RDS, EC2/ECS).
  • Data Visualization: Proven experience with Power BI and Spotfire (or similar) for scientific and analytical dashboards/visualizations.
  • Frontend (preferred): Modern JavaScript/TypeScript frameworks (React preferred), responsive UI development, and component libraries.
  • Testing & Quality: Strong unit testing skills; experience writing automated tests with mock data for robust coverage.
  • Tools & Practices: Git for version control; API design (RESTful); CI/CD; clean code and reusable library development.
  • Core Competencies
  • Excellent reverse engineering and troubleshooting capabilities for complex data and system issues.
  • Strong problem-solving skills with attention to detail and commitment to data quality/accuracy.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in cross-functional, scientific teams.
  • Excellent communication skills to bridge technical concepts with non-technical stakeholders (scientists, researchers).

Utility Construction Project Manager
✦ New
Salary not disclosed
Indianapolis, IN 8 hours ago

Job Description

The Project Manager is the key to coordination between the design team, field team, major account agents, and our customers in a power utility environment. The Project Manager will manage projects from the T&D Capital Project Portfolio, focusing on power infrastructure. The Project Manager will oversee budgets ranging from $100K to $20M that span across Transmission, Distribution, and Substation assets.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Working closely with the project’s Engineering Led to set priorities, prepare project schedules, and work in a team-based environment with a focus on delivery and quality
  • Carefully manage customer requirements and schedules with internal team.
  • Acting as a liaison between multiple departments, including engineering, construction, operations, major account agents, stakeholder management and regulatory teams, to facilitate seamless communication and alignment
  • Coordinate project teams while serving as the primary point of contact to help resolve any issues
  • Collaborating with cross-functional teams to ensure that all deadlines are met
  • Schedule and attend Project Update meetings with both internal and external project teams
  • Ensure project documentation is accurate, up-to-date, and posted in the project folder.
  • Follow-up with construction coordinator to make sure as-builts from the field get to the drafting department.
  • Follow up on invoicing and assist with closing project Purchase Orders.
  • Assist with closing out work orders.
  • Monitor project costs and assist project owners with monthly forecasting.
  • Conduct 2 Safety Walks per month

Education Requirements:

Bachelor’s degree in construction or project management is a plus

PMP Certification is a plus

Experience Desired:

- 5+ years of previous Project Management experience within Electric utility supporting substations, transmission lines, distribution, or generation

- proficient within Microsoft Excel and SAP software

- Primavera P6 experience preferred

Project Manager | Heavy Civil
✦ New
Salary not disclosed
Indianapolis, IN 8 hours ago

Responsibilities and Tasks:

  • Primary responsibility will be managing field operations and contract administration including safety, personnel, subcontract scheduling, material and equipment procurement and schedule
  • Safety planning will play a critical role in all planning and field operations activities
  • Contract management from the standpoint of identifying potential change orders, changes in scope, changes in field conditions, changes in ability to perform as bid with means and methods
  • Creating and managing budgets
  • Managing Subcontractor and Vendor relationships including identifying and mitigating potential risk exposure and cost overrun exposure
  • Responsible for planning applicable equipment types, personnel skill sets, means, methods, and updating schedule
  • Maintain accurate cost accounting, accurate schedule impacts, accurate and fully authorized change order logs, and accurate and updated communication logs
  • Submit monthly cost to complete projections
  • Manage the contract value amount as it is affected by weather, changed conditions, authorized change orders, pending change orders, and accurate quantities completed
  • Weekly quantities completed accurately reported and compiled in Viewpoint
  • Budget changes completed accurately on a weekly basis
  • All change orders agreed and signed and reconciled every 30 days upstream to the customer and downstream to vendors and subcontractors
  • Change order log updated to verify current contract amount
  • Purchase order committed costs accurately tracked and recorded
  • Other duties as assigned


Knowledge/Skills/Abilities

  • 5-20 years of Project Management in heavy civil construction
  • Excellent communication skills, ability to find solutions from problems, and team approach to management
  • OSHA 30 Hour
  • Bachelor's Degree in Construction Management, Civil Engineering or related degree. A combination of education and experience will be considered in lieu of a degree
